In real-world elevator applications, every part inside the balance system has a job to do. If the filler weight is poorly matched, I may see unnecessary vibration, inefficient traction behavior, uneven loading, or wasted room inside the counterweight structure. When I choose High-Density Elevator Filler Weights, I am choosing a solution that helps deliver the required mass in a more compact form. That matters because elevator systems often have tight dimensional limits, and every design decision affects assembly, movement, and long-term serviceability.
A higher-density approach is especially useful when I need to maximize balancing effect without increasing the size of the filled section too much. This can support cleaner structural layout and improve compatibility with demanding elevator configurations. For buyers, that translates into a more practical path to achieving design goals without sacrificing reliability.

One of the biggest reasons I would consider High-Density Elevator Filler Weights is the ability to place more effective mass into a controlled area. In elevator engineering, space is rarely unlimited. Designers often need to meet load and balance targets inside restricted frames or defined equipment envelopes. A lower-density solution may require more volume to reach the same effect, which can complicate system layout.
With a dense filler solution, I can often approach the same balancing goal in a more compact way. That makes planning easier, especially when I am working with design limitations or trying to optimize component arrangement. Compactness alone is not enough, of course. The weight must also be reliable, durable, and suitable for the intended installation method. That is why material quality and manufacturing control remain central to the decision.
